8 Crabtree Close is a two-bedroom detached house in Beaconsfield (HP9 1UQ). It has a recorded floor area of 127 m² (around 1364 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(July 2009) shows a D (score 58), a step below the typical UK home.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 74). The latest certificate is from July 2009,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Untraded for 16 years, with the last transfer in March 2010. Today's modelled estimate of £657,000 sits 59.3% above the 2010 sale of £412,500. 2 planning records sit against the property, 0 approved, 0 refused.
